It is permissible for fiber optic cable to be wrapped or coiled as long as the minimum bend radius constraints are not violated. While fiber optic cables are typically stronger than copper cables, it is still important that the cable maximum pulling tension not be exceeded during any phase of cable. Never pull on the connector. Do not exceed the maximum tensile load. Many installers pull fiber by the outer jacket which is prone to. On long runs, use proper lubricants and make sure they are compatible with the cable jacket.

Fiber optic joints or terminations - where cables are terminated - are made two ways: 1) connectors that mate two fibers to create a temporary joint and/or connect the fiber to a piece of network gear (left) or 2) splices which create a permanent joint between the two fibers (right).
